Women of Mexico

This new installation in our Women of the World Series is light and vibrant with a natural sweetness and some pleasant acidity.

Roaster's Tasting Notes:

Apricot Jam, Shortbread, Almond

  • Country: Mexico
  • Region: Huatusco, Veracruz
  • Farm/Co-op: Nantic
  • Elevation: 1200 MASL
  • Varietal: Catamor, Caturra, Typica, Bourbon
  • Process: Washed
  • Roast level: Light
  • Rainforest Alliance Certified

Our newest Women of the World Series coffee comes from a cooperative in central Mexico. The community is of indigenous Mayan ancestry and is led by 222 women who oversee 475 hectares of land. They grow both their own food and coffee to sell on this land.

Por Mas Cafe is a program run by the Mexican government to aid coffee production and producers. Its goal is to provide education and resources for farmers to thrive as coffee producers, while also ensuring they are fairly and consistently paid for their product. It can help producers pay for and work towards the expensive (up front cost) Rainforest Alliance Certification which will allow producers to receive higher profit over time for their coffee.

These farms are run using traditional methods passed down through the generations. They need to keep the ecosystem balanced as the land is also their source of food. Many coffee growing communities around the world use these "agroforestry" methods to grow their coffee. Almost all these agroforestry communities would qualify for Rainforest Alliance Certification, but very few can afford the cost associated with getting the actual certificate to be guaranteed a higher price for their coffee.
